Key Factors to Check Before Trusting an HNI Database Provider

1. Data Source Transparency

You must understand where the data comes from.

Check:

  • Whether sources are structured and verified

  • Whether data is collected systematically

If the provider cannot explain sources clearly, reliability is questionable.


2. Data Freshness and Update Frequency

HNI data changes quickly.

Ask:

  • How often is the database updated?

  • Is there a regular update system?

As explained in Why HNI Databases Need Regular Updates in India , outdated data reduces effectiveness.


3. Data Accuracy and Validation Process

Check how the provider validates data.

A strong provider:

  • Removes inactive profiles

  • Verifies business activity

  • Updates key details

4. Segmentation Quality

Good providers do not give random data.

They offer structured segmentation:

  • Industry

  • Location

  • Role

  • Wealth category

5. Coverage and Depth

Check:

  • City-wise coverage

  • Industry coverage

  • Dataset depth

For example, location-specific datasets like Mumbai HNI Database provide more focused targeting.


6. Data Relevance to Your Use Case

Not all HNI data fits every business.

You must check:

  • Industry relevance

  • Investment behavior

  • Business alignment

Generic datasets often fail.


7. Compliance and Data Responsibility

Ensure the provider follows proper practices:

  • Ethical data handling

  • Clear usage guidelines

Compliance is critical for long-term reliability.


8. Ability to Support Validation

A good provider supports validation.

You should combine data with real-world checks.
